LIV Golf files for bankruptcy with millions in debt to star players
Saudi Arabia’s Public Investment Fund, which stopped financing LIV this year, will provide $49.6 million to keep it operating during the restructuring

Saudi-backed LIV Golf filed for bankruptcy, revealing millions of dollars in debts to some of its biggest stars after the upstart league burned through some $5 billion in four years.
